Berglandmilch eGen, a company based in Wels, Austria, has voluntarily initiated a recall of their ja! Corny Fresh Cheese 0.1% product. This precautionary measure was taken out of responsibility for consumer health and product safety due to the potential presence of metal wire contaminants in the product.
The affected product is the ja! Corny Fresh Cheese 0.1% 200g, with the Best Before Date (BBD) of 11.08.2025. The EAN Code for the recalled product is 43 37256 94458 8. This recall was announced to ensure consumer safety and prevent any risk of injury from metal fragments, which could pose a serious health hazard if ingested.

Consumers are advised to check the batch numbers, production dates, and packaging details of their ja! Corny Fresh Cheese 0.1% 200g to identify the potentially contaminated items. If the product falls under the recall, it's recommended to either return it to the place of purchase for a full refund (regardless of the absence of a receipt) or dispose of it safely and avoid consuming it.

The recall was reported by news aktuell, and Berglandmilch eGen has apologised for any inconvenience caused and assured that they are investigating the cause and taking steps to prevent recurrence. A technical malfunction may have led to the affected product containing parts of a metal wire.
